B.C.A. Dec 2007.
Electronic Devices Ciruits
Time : 3 hours Maximum : 100 marks
ans any 5 ques..
1. (a) Convert every of these hexadecimal numbers to its decimal equivalent. (10)
(i) FF (ii) A4
(iii) 9B (iv) 3C.
(b) Convert the subsequent hexadecimal numbers to their decimal equivalents : (10)
(i) 0FFF (ii) 3FFF
(iii) 7FE4 (iv) B3D8.
2. (a) Draw a 1-of-10 binary to decimal decoder circuit. What is the Boolean formula for every Y output? (10)
(b) Draw a four input X-OR gate circuit with 2 input X-OR gates and verify its truth table. (10)
3. (a) Draw the circuit diagram of Half-subtractor and verify its truth table. (10)
(b) Output 1’s appear in the truth table for these input conditions ABCD = 0001, ABCD = 0110 and ABCD = 1110 what is the sum of products formula. (10)
4. (a) Define the subsequent : (10)
(i) Don’t care condition
(ii) Karnaugh map
(iii) Octet
(iv) Redundant group.
(b) Define the subsequent : (10)
(i) Decoder
(ii) Demultiplexer
(iii) Multiplexer
(iv) Parity generator.
5. (a) Draw the circuit diagram of D-flip-flop and discuss the timing diagram. (10)
(b) Draw the circuit diagram of JK master-slave flip flop and discuss the timing diagram. (10)
6. (a) Draw a circuit diagram of Ripple counter built with JK flip flop and discuss how the counter works. (10)
(b) Draw the circuit diagram of down counter and discuss how a down counter counts from 1111 to 0000. (10)
7. (a) Draw the circuit diagram of op-amp as inverting summing amplifier and derive the formula. (10)
(b) Draw the circuit diagram of Op-amp as adder-subtractor and arrive at the equation . (10)
8. (a) Explain any 2 op-amp non-ideal dc characteristics. (10)
(b) Explain any 2 op-amp ac characteristics. (10)
